Luggage

When it comes to luggage, a lot of us like to go see them in the store, and some of you may end up being scared they may arrive to you damaged if you order them online. However, if you already know what luggage company you like when it comes to sizing and quality, the best bet you have is to buy online since you will be able to find those types of luggage for cheaper if you choose to bypass getting them in person.

Not only do stores like Macy’s, Overstock, and eBags let you filter through their bags based on color, size, brand, and features, but you will also be able to find them for cheaper online. Stores like JCPenny and Macy’s end up selling their luggage slightly cheaper online than in the store, and if you are lucky enough, you can find your favorite luggage on sale for up to or even over 50% for big sales such as Black Friday or even President’s Day’s sale!

The only catch you need to make sure of before you buy these items is to read the return policy and make sure you can return them for free within a certain time frame. It is always better to be safe than sorry, just in case you do not like something about the item, luggage included.
